Mazda CX-5 Owners Manual: Vent Operation

Adjusting the Vents

Directing airflow

To adjust the direction of airflow, move the adjustment knob.

NOTE

hen using the air conditioner under humid ambient temperature conditions, the system may blow fog from the vents. This is not a sign of trouble but a result of humid air being suddenly cooled.
